Rheological responses of microgel suspensions with temperature-responsive capillary networks

Abstract: A method coupling microgel jamming and temperature-responsive capillary networking is developed to manipulate the rheological properties of microgel-capillary suspensions by microgel sizes, the fraction of capillary solution, and temperature after...

“…PNIPAm microgels were synthesized from the water-in-oil template reported in our previous work . The aqueous phase, PNIPAm precursor solution, was prepared by mixing a monomer (NIPAm, 2 M), a cross-linker (BIS, 0.13 M) and a photoinitiator (I-2959, 0.4 wt %) following the compositions shown in Table in deionized (DI) water using a vortex mixer (MX-S, Dlab, USA) until all chemicals dissolved at 23 °C.…”
